  • Publication number: 20210125538
    Abstract: A portable information handling system integrated organic light emitting diode (OLED) display presents a compensation image having pixels illuminated at predetermined color and luminance settings. The compensation image is captured by a external camera as a calibration image and analyzed to compare pixel color and luminance provided by the OLED display with expected color and luminance to determine pixel compensation values that correct the OLED display for presentation of a uniform visual image that reproduces an intended visual image when the compensation values are applied at presentation of visual images by the OLED display.

  • Patent number: 10908846
    Abstract: A memory system may include: a memory pool including a plurality of memory regions; and a controller suitable for controlling the memory pool, wherein each of the memory regions includes one or more row groups, each row group having a predetermined row group size, and wherein the controller counts the numbers of row accesses to the respective memory regions, determines row group sizes according to the row access counts of the respective memory regions, increases a representative access count of a row group including a certain row when the row is accessed, and provides a command to the memory pool to perform a target refresh operation on a target row group whose representative access count exceeds a threshold value.

  • Publication number: 20200384023
    Abstract: The present invention relates to a new antibody or an antigen binding fragment thereof for use in the treatment of cancer by targeting a B cell malignancy, a chimeric antigen receptor comprising the same, and a use of the same. The antibody of the present invention is an antibody for specifically binding to CD19 that is highly expressed in cancer cells (particularly, blood cancer), has very low homology to a CDR sequence thereof compared to a CDR sequence of a conventional CD19 target antibody so that the sequence thereof is unique, and specifically binds to an epitope that is different from a FMC63 antibody fragment binding to CD19 of the conventional art. A cell expressing the chimeric antigen receptor comprising an anti-CD19 antibody or the antigen binding fragment of the present invention induces immune cell activity in response to a positive cell line expressing CD19.

  • Patent number: 10838537
    Abstract: An environmental sensor for an electronic device includes a substrate, a first sensing unit having a first sensor electrode disposed on the substrate, a second sensing unit having a second sensor electrode disposed on the substrate, an insulating layer covering the first sensor electrode, and a cover that is disposed over the first and second sensor electrodes, the cover including at least one hole through which chemical particles pass. The first and second sensing units each sense one of a capacitance-change due to the chemical particles that pass through the hole and then adhere to the insulating layer located on the first sensor electrode and a resistance-change due to the chemical particles that pass through the hole and then adhere to the second sensor electrode.
